Minimalism and Focus
- Minimize material possessions and evaluate everything in your life, including business components and offerings.
- Focus on the 20% of things providing 80% of the value, cutting out excess for better focus.
Environmental Impact on Self
- You become the shape of the space you spend time in, influencing your physical and mental state.
- Design your environment to support movement and well-being, incorporating elements like open space and natural views.
Adaptability of the Human Body
- The human body continually adapts to its environment, even in adulthood.
- You can make significant movement improvements regardless of your upbringing, as your body is always under construction.
